Bulk URL Duplicate Checker
Identify and remove duplicate links instantly. Clean up your sitemaps and SEO lists.
⚠️ Duplicate Groups
✅ Unique List Copied!
How to Use This Tool
- Paste URLs: Copy your list from Excel, XML sitemap, or text file and paste it into the box.
- Adjust Options: Use the checkboxes to decide if
httpvshttpsmatters, or if query parameters (like?utm_source) should be ignored. - Run Check: Click "Check Duplicates" to instantly process the data locally in your browser.
- Export: Use the copy buttons to grab the cleaned list or isolate the duplicate entries for further analysis.
Key Features
Instant Analysis
Processes up to 10,000 URLs in milliseconds using optimized client-side logic.
100% Private
No data is sent to our servers. All deduplication happens right in your web browser.
Smart Filters
Ignore trailing slashes or protocols to find "true" duplicates that other tools miss.
Detailed Grouping
Doesn't just remove duplicates—it groups them so you can see exactly which versions collide.
Clean Output
Automatically trims whitespace and empty lines for a ready-to-use URL list.
Mobile Ready
Fully functional on smartphones and tablets for quick SEO checks on the go.
How It Works
This tool uses a normalization algorithm to compare URLs. When you click check, it processes each line through a standardizer:
Process(URL) = Trim() → Lowercase() → StripProtocol() → StripQuery()It creates a "fingerprint" for each URL. If two different lines produce the same fingerprint (e.g., example.com/page/ and example.com/page), they are flagged as duplicates based on your settings.
Practical Examples
🇮🇳 1. E-commerce Product Cleanup
Scenario: A store owner in Delhi has a product list where some links have /product/ and others have /product/?id=123.
Action: Using "Ignore Query Params", the tool identifies these as the same page, preventing duplicate content issues in the sitemap.
🇺🇸 2. Migration Audit
Scenario: An SEO agency migrates a site from HTTP to HTTPS. The report contains mixed links.
Action: Using "Ignore Protocol", the tool treats http://site.com and https://site.com as duplicates, helping consolidate the final list.
🌍 3. Global Marketing List
Scenario: A marketing team merges three email lists containing profile URLs.
Action: The tool instantly removes 500+ exact duplicates, saving money on email marketing credits.
What is Duplicate URL Checking?
Duplicate URLs occur when the same page is accessible via multiple web addresses. This confuses search engines, wastes crawl budget, and splits ranking power. A bulk checker helps you consolidate these lists effortlessly.
International Terms
Frequently Asked Questions
Is this tool free?
Yes, it is completely free to use instantly. No signup required.
How many URLs can I check?
We recommend up to 10,000 URLs per batch for optimal browser performance, though it can often handle more.
Does it delete my original list?
No, your input remains in the text box. The results are shown below it, so you can always adjust settings and re-run.
What implies a "Duplicate Group"?
A group is a set of URLs that match based on your filter settings. For example, http and https versions of the same link form one group.
Can I ignore case sensitivity?
Yes, the "Case Insensitive" option is checked by default, meaning /Page and /page are treated as duplicates.
Does this work for emails?
Yes! While designed for URLs, you can paste email addresses or any text lines to remove exact duplicates.
Recommended Hosting
Hostinger
If you are building a website for your tools, blog, or store, reliable hosting matters for speed and uptime. Hostinger is a popular option used worldwide.
Visit Hostinger →Disclosure: This is a sponsored link.
Contact Us
Related Tools You May Like
Share This Tool
Found this tool useful? Share it with friends and colleagues.